Coal-mining in West Virginia totaled 13,988 jobs in 2019, with 10,647 jobs located in underground mines and 3,3341 jobs dedicated to surface mines. Based on underground coal mine production, West Virginia is one of the top states in the country. In the Appalachian region, where West Virginia is located, there were nearly 30,000 coal mining jobs in 2018, up from nearly 29,600 in 2017.

From above link. US solar jobs in 2018 about 335,000.
The Solar Foundation reports long-term growth: between 2013 and 2018, solar employment grew 11 percent annuallysix times faster than overall U.S. employment. Both USEER and The Solar Foundation defined a full-time solar job as one held by an individual who spends at least 50 percent of their time on solar-related work. According to the BLS, solar photovoltaic installers is the fastest growing occupation across the entire economy.
From above link for 2018. The American Wind Energy Association (AWEA) reports 114,000 jobs in the wind power industry. IRENA corroborates this estimate, also reporting 114,000 wind jobs. AWEA specifies that these jobs are spread across all 50 states, which means there are factory and manufacturing jobs even in states that do not have wind farms. The industry is growing, especially for turbine service technicians, which was the second-fastest growing occupation across the entire economy in 2018.
